Specializes in commercial litigation in the areas of secured and unsecured collections, insolvency and restructuring matters. Catherine regularly conducts civil and commercial litigation matters in the Court of Queen's Bench and Court of Appeal.
Catherine also provides advice and representation to clients in relation to employment and labour matters.
